A program known as the HARP has been created so homeowners can refinance their home even if they are not in a good situation. Discuss a HARP refinance with your lender. Make sure that you avoid binge shopping trips when you are in the waiting period for a mortgage preapproval to formally close. Too much spending may send up a red flag to your lender when they run a second credit check a day or two before your scheduled meeting. Wait until the loan is closed to spend a lot on purchases.

Credit History
Make certain your credit history is in good order before applying for a mortgage. Lenders check your credit history carefully to ensure you are a safe credit risk. Repair your credit if it’s poor to increase your chances at getting a mortgage.
Get your financial documents together before visiting a lender. In particular, gather bank statements and your proof of income. Having these things on hand and organized before you go to get a loan will make everything go a little faster as your loan is processed.
Find out the property taxes before making an offer on a home. Before signing a contract, you should know how much the property taxes are going to cost you. You might find the tax assessor values your property higher than you expected and you don’t want to have any unpleasant surprises.
Speak with many lenders before selecting the one you want to borrow from. Check out reputations with people you know and online, along with any hidden fees and rates within the contracts. Once you have a complete understand of what each offers, you can make the right choice.
If you want an easy approval, go for a balloon mortgage. This loan has a shorter term, and the balance owed on the mortgage needs to be refinanced when the term of the loan expires. It’s a risky chance to take as rates tend to only go up.
Pay more towards the principal every month that you can. This will help you to reconcile the mortgage loan at a faster rate. Paying an extra $100 every month will go towards the principal, and that allows you to pay down the loan much faster.
